Overview: The recent Hillside School Board meeting covered a range of issues, including the revision of cell phone policies, advancements in STEM education, mental health initiatives, and community engagement. Superintendent Erskine R. Glover and board members discussed strategies to enhance academic performance and foster a supportive educational environment.

Overview: The Union Township Town Council meeting saw the adoption of a controversial Master Plan reexamination and land use amendment, despite public opposition. The meeting also highlighted the township’s 250th birthday essay contest winners and addressed various ordinances, resolutions, and community concerns, including increased traffic accidents and persistent drainage issues.
